Norway - Import of Alcoholic Grape Must

Since 2014, Norway Import of Alcoholic Grape Must was down by 1.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 12 comparing other countries in Import of Alcoholic Grape Must at $97,743,833.77. Norway is overtaken by Portugal, which was number 11 at $100,629,000.78 and is followed by Switzerland with $97,170,768. Germany ranked the highest with $710,579,122.41 in 2019, that is a decrease of 3.4%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, France and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Argentina witnessed the best average annual growth at +214.5% per year, while Nepal was the worst growing country at -50.6% per year.
